| Description | In this paper the authors report the first catalytic enantioselective addition of arylboronic acids and alkenyl N-methyliminodiacetic acid (MIDA) boronate to β-substituted alkenylheteroarenes. Various types of substrates were employed, containing π-deficient quinoline, quinoxaline, pyrimidine moieties as well as π-excessive oxazole and oxadiazole fragments; the products were obtained in 56-91% yields and with 89-98% ee. Introduction of the alkenyl moiety could be accomplished via alkenyl MIDA boronates. Microwave irradiation could be replaced by thermal heating. |
